Where each one shines
What Vanguard Brokerage and Ziggma each do best.What Vanguard Brokerage does best
- Individual, joint, IRA, custodial, education, trust, estate, and eligible organization accounts.
- Vanguard and third-party mutual funds, ETFs, stocks, options, Treasuries, bonds, and brokered CDs.
- Dollar-based Vanguard ETF investing from $1 and recurring investment workflows.
- Choice of Vanguard Cash Deposit or VMFXX as the brokerage settlement option.
- Web and mobile portfolio administration, statements, tax forms, beneficiaries, and transfers.
What Ziggma does best
- Tracking portfolios across linked brokerage and retirement accounts, CSV uploads, and manual or virtual portfolios, with consolidated performance, allocation, and risk views.
- Account linking through third-party aggregation providers where supported; Ziggma states it does not access or store broker login credentials and uses OAuth where available.
- Screening for stocks and ETFs with slider-based filters, real-time-updating results, saved screen presets, and watchlist actions.
- Ziggma Stock Score for a 0-100 fundamentals-based rating built around growth, profitability, valuation, financial strength, and related quality dimensions.
- Monitoring dividend income, portfolio yield, and dividend opportunities across accounts and holdings.

Questions we keep getting
What's the difference between Vanguard Brokerage and Ziggma?
Vanguard Brokerage leans toward brokerage, portfolio, and watchlist, while Ziggma puts more weight on stock ideas, screeners, and ETF screeners. They overlap in 2 categories, so for most people it comes down to workflow preference and price.
Is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ma free to use?
Ziggma has a free tier, so you can get started without paying anything. Vanguard Brokerage is paid-only. If budget matters, start with Ziggma and see how far it takes you before opening your wallet.
Can I use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ma on my phone?
Vanguard Brokerage lists a dedicated mobile app, so it travels better. Ziggma doesn't list a dedicated mobile app; its documented access is web.
Should I choose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ma?
It depends on what you're after. Pick Vanguard Brokerage if brokerage and downloadable tax reports matter to you; go with Ziggma if you'd rather have stock ideas and screeners. And if you only need the basics both share, let price decide.
What asset classes do Vanguard Brokerage and Ziggma cover?
Both cover stocks, ETFs, and mutual funds. Vanguard Brokerage also handles options and bonds.
Does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ma have real-time data?
Ziggma offers real-time data, which matters if you trade actively. Vanguard Brokerage runs on delayed or end-of-day data, which is perfectly fine for longer-term investors who don't live and die by the tick.
Can I export data from Vanguard Brokerage and Ziggma?
Vanguard Brokerage exports to CSV. Ziggma is stingier about getting data out.
Which has a better stock screener: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ma?
Ziggma has a stock screener for surfacing ideas; Vanguard Brokerage doesn't, and focuses its energy elsewhere.
Can I track my portfolio with Vanguard Brokerage or Ziggma?
Yes, both do portfolio tracking: holdings, performance, and allocation in one place.
